This is an exam question from the Traffic Rules of Ukraine concerning road safety and the correct behavior of participants after a traffic accident. It reminds us that a passenger is not an “outsider”: in a critical situation, the passenger may be the only person able to react quickly, help the injured, and ensure proper notification of the services, which directly affects the lives and health of people and the subsequent processing of the incident.

The question tests knowledge of Section 5 of the Traffic Rules, specifically the duties and rights of passengers. According to clause 5.4, in the event of an accident, a passenger of the involved vehicle is required to act in two ways: provide possible assistance to the victims and report the incident to the authority or authorized unit of the National Police, remaining at the scene until the police arrive. That is why the theoretical exam includes a combined option that covers both obligations.

An analysis of the answer options shows that “helping the victims” alone is correct, but incomplete, because the traffic rules additionally require notifying the police and staying at the scene. Likewise, “notifying the police and staying” meets the requirements of the rules, but does not fulfill the duty to provide possible assistance. In practice, this means: calling an ambulance if necessary, helping the injured within your abilities, recording the contacts of witnesses, and providing important explanations to the police, without leaving the scene of the accident until law enforcement arrives.

Clause 5.4

In the event of a road traffic accident, a passenger of the vehicle involved in the accident must provide possible assistance to the victims, report the incident to the authority or authorized unit of the National Police, and remain at the scene until the police arrive.

Application: this clause directly establishes the duties of a passenger of a vehicle involved in a traffic accident, in particular regarding providing possible assistance to victims and notifying the police (as well as remaining at the scene until the police arrive).

That is, the correct answer is "Answers 1 and 2," given that according to the Traffic Rules, a passenger involved in a traffic accident must provide possible assistance to the victims and report the incident to the authority or authorized unit of the National Police.

A passenger involved in a traffic accident is not a “mere bystander.” The Traffic Rules of Ukraine explicitly classify the passenger as a participant in road traffic and assign them certain responsibilities in the event of an accident, especially if the driver is injured or unable to act independently.

First and foremost, the passenger must provide all possible assistance to the victims. This refers to real actions within their capabilities: calling an ambulance, helping to move people to a safe place, stopping bleeding, or performing other simple first aid actions if they are able to do so and it does not create additional danger.

Next, the passenger must report the incident to the relevant authority or authorized unit of the National Police (and to medical personnel if necessary) and remain at the scene until the police arrive. This is important both for the proper documentation of the accident and for preserving the circumstances of the event, as well as because the passenger may provide important explanations as a witness.

Therefore, the correct answer is "Answers 1 and 2," since a passenger involved in a traffic accident is required to provide possible assistance to the victims, notify the police, and remain at the scene until the police arrive.
